Output 34d8ec4cb2b0cb24d460df3306441a14e20f17e9e808cce66a95281df3e63b81:1

value
59074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f936aaaf535552b8588cb63efadadfdd3f38c3a6 OP_EQUAL
address
3QQjfcyVDMgLXdfauZDRGWNzi77HMNTEaX
transaction
34d8ec4cb2b0cb24d460df3306441a14e20f17e9e808cce66a95281df3e63b81
spent
true